3 April 2018 – Russian President Vladimir Putin will meet Turkish President Recep Tayyip Erdogan on Tuesday in Ankara, where they will follow the ground-breaking ceremony for Turkey’s first nuclear power plant (RFE/RL), built with Russian support, over video conference, the Kremlin said. Iranian President Hassan Rouhani will join the pair on Wednesday to discuss trilateral efforts to negotiate an end to the Syrian conflict (Hurriyet).

“The prospect of Russia, Turkey and Iran agreeing what a new status quo inside Syria should look like is a short-term stopgap at best, and one that overlooks the underlying and unresolved causes of the war,” Nick Paton Walsh writes for CNN.
“Instead of trumpeting each new ceasefire as a first step toward peace – when their basic terms are the same as those of previous failed ceasefires—bogus ceasefires need to be seen as integral to Assad’s military strategy,” Mohammed Alaa Ghanem writes for Chatham House.
“Turkey’s military campaign on [the Syrian city of] Afrin and the expansion of its own influence on the ground in Syria also means that the Syrian regime will find it difficult to extend its military control in the north west because that would put it in direct confrontation with Turkey. This further challenges the notion that the Syrian regime is ‘winning’ the war in Syria,” Lina Khatib writes for Asharq Al-Awsat.
